SYNOPSIS:

Edwin Santora is the kind of man every woman wants to be “friends” with.

He was Abigail’s first love, the love of her life, but when the devastatingly handsome Edwin admitted he just wasn’t ready to settle down and have kids, Abigail was left back at ground zero surrounded by the remnants of her shattered heart.  Convinced that he can win Abigail back, Edwin bides his time and waits for his chance to reclaim her body and her heart.

Cameron Clarke is what dreams are made of.

He was the man of Abigail’s dreams and she was smitten.  She hadn’t actually expected that he would fall for her, but he did; which only makes the clean-up that much messier after he drops a bomb that shocks everyone.  Lost without her, and with his motherless little girl’s broken heart on the line, Cameron’s determined to stop Edwin from stealing his future; but is it too late for him?

Torn between these two men who stand to give her everything she ever wanted, who will Abigail choose?
